well In a '89 Hatch I had to make adapter brackets to fit the seat to the stock rails. The '89 and the 92-95 dont have mounts in the same place, the outer rail is about 2-3 inches from where it needs to be. The rear can be made to fit much easier. I have th full set from a '93 in my '89 hatch. Was told you can use the older base with the new backs and use the new cover on the old base. I didn't do that since my base was a mess. Foam was disintegrating. and the foam wouldn't swap since pan shape was different. If you are into some fabrication, it isn't real hard some angle iron some 1X1 or 1X2 box stock (use it on one side so seat sits level)something to cut and grind with and it can be done in an afternoon. I used the '89 barckets and modified the '93 seats so I could bolt the adapter I built to fasten one to the other. and fit stock floorpan. I assume the '90 seats aren't substantialy different than '89 seats. except for seat belt mounts. The '92-95 seats have both mounts on the outer sides of the seat, the '89 had the indide mount at the seat edge but the outside mount is about 4 inches in from the seat edge. so you see why custom adapter is needed. Dont drill through the pan to bolt the new seat up, you don't want to go through the windshield with your new seat strapped to your *** when you hit something do you.
